Connecting to Video Equipment Using an S-video or a Composite Video Cable (INPUT 3 or 4)

Using an S-video or a composite video cable, a VCR, DVD player or other video equipment can be connected to INPUT 3 or INPUT 4 input terminal.

1 Connect an S-video cable or a composite video cable to the projector.

S-video cable: to INPUT 3 terminal

Composite video cable: to INPUT 4 terminal

2 Connect the above cable to the video equipment.

S-video cable: to S-video output ter- minal

Composite video cable: to video out- put terminal
